प्रश्न

sec 60° = ?

विकल्प

  • `1/2`

  • 2

  • `2/sqrt(3)`

  • `sqrt(3)`

  • `sqrt(2)`

MCQ
Advertisements

उत्तर

2

Explanation:

`sec θ = 1/(cos θ)`

Since `cos 60^circ = 1/2`

`sec 60^circ = 1 ÷ (1/2)`

= 2
